Версия 17.1 от writer на 2023/02/22 16:52

Скрыть последних авторов
og 2.1 1 PUMOTIX с модулем «Плазменная резка» поддерживает два основных режима управления резкой:
2
knetyaga 6.1 3 1. Режим управления осью Z и подачей резки из параметров процесса резки в PUMOTIX;
og 2.1 4 1. Режим управления осью Z и подачей резки из G-кода.
5
knetyaga 6.1 6 (% style="text-align: left;" %)
writer 11.1 7 ===== (% style="color:#007a7a" %)**Управление резкой из параметров процесса PUMOTIX**(%%) =====
og 2.1 8
writer 17.1 9 При активации данного режима игнорируются любые команды управления осью Z и подачей F из G-кода. Данный режим позволяет полностью контролировать процесс плазменной резки, устанавливая все рабочие параметры непосредственно в окне программы (вкладка «Рабочие параметры»). Например, в УП встречается следующий набор команд:
og 2.1 10
writer 13.1 11 {{code language="none"}}
og 2.1 12 N0030 G21 (Units: Metric)
13 N0040 G90 G91.1 G40
14 N0050 F1
15 N0060 M101
16 N0070 G00 Z10.0000
17 N0080 G00 X75.8800 Y410.0000
18 N0090 M100
19 N0100 G00 Z3.0000
20 N0110 M03
21 N0120 G00 Z1.5000
22 N0130 G02 X75.8800 Y410.0000 I0.0000 J55.8800 F3000
23 N0140 M05
writer 12.1 24 {{/code}}
og 2.1 25
26 В данном примере команды управления осью Z (подъем на высоту пробоя и спуск на рабочую высоту), а так же установка подачи резки 3000 ед. будут проигнорированы программой.
27
writer 13.1 28 {{code language="none"}}
29 N0100 G00 Z3.0000
30 N0120 G00 Z1.5000
31 N0130 G02 X75.8800 Y410.0000 I0.0000 J55.8800 F3000
32 {{/code}}
og 2.1 33
writer 12.1 34 Для работы системы в таком режиме в G-коде достаточно двух стандартных управляющих команд — макросов **[[(% style="color:#8d69b2" %)**М03/М04**>>doc:Руководство пользователя.Описание M-кодов.Стандартные M-коды модуля плазменной резки.WebHome]](%%)** и макроса **[[(% style="color:#8d69b2" %)**М05**>>doc:Руководство пользователя.Описание M-кодов.Стандартные M-коды модуля плазменной резки.WebHome]](%%)**. Таким образом, никаких дополнительных параметров в файле УП не требуется, что позволяет использовать любой стандартный пост-процессор для CAM-систем с **[[(% style="color:#8d69b2" %)**М03/М04**>>doc:Руководство пользователя.Описание M-кодов.Стандартные M-коды модуля плазменной резки.WebHome]](%%)** и **[[(% style="color:#8d69b2" %)**М05**>>doc:Руководство пользователя.Описание M-кодов.Стандартные M-коды модуля плазменной резки.WebHome]](%%)** командами.
og 2.1 35
knetyaga 6.1 36 (% style="text-align: left;" %)
writer 11.1 37 ===== (% style="color:#007a7a" %)**Управление резкой из G-кода**(%%) =====
og 2.1 38
39 Данный режим предусматривает управление подачей резки, а также перемещениями оси Z непосредственно из G-кода. Этот режим целесообразно использовать совместно с правилами резки в CAM- программе, из которой потом будет выгружен готовый G-код для PUMOTIX. Большинство CAM-пакетов поддерживают установку и настройку правил прохождения контура (правил резки). Еще на этапе генерации операции резки можно настроить замедления перед прохождением крутых поворотов контура, вставить макросы включения и отключения регулирования, подъема резака на безопасную высоту и т.д. Таким образом, результирующий G-код будет содержать в себе некоторый перечень команд по управлению подачей и перемещениями оси Z, который PUMOTIX исполнит при выполнении УП. При выборе данного режима управления резкой, игнорирование строк
40
writer 16.1 41 {{code class="non-break" language="none"}}
writer 13.1 42 N0100 G00 Z3.0000
43 N0120 G00 Z1.5000 F100
44 N0130 G02 X75.8800 Y410.0000 I0.0000 J55.8800 F3000
45 {{/code}}
og 2.1 46
47 не будет производиться. Система выполнит указанный в G-коде подъем на высоту пробоя Z3.000, включит факел и произведет переезд оси Z в координату рабочей высоты Z1.1500. В строке N0130 будет произведен рез контура с подачей 3000 ед/мин.
48
49 Заметим, что в этом режиме следующие значения параметров с вкладки «рабочие параметры» будут проигнорированы:
50 • подача резки;
51 • высота поджига дуги;
52 • рабочая высота резки;
53 • высота холостых переездов.
54
writer 12.1 55 Стоит отметить, что в этом режиме команда **[[(% style="color:#8d69b2" %)**M3**>>doc:Руководство пользователя.Описание M-кодов.Стандартные M-коды модуля плазменной резки.WebHome]](%%)** не выполняет поиск материала. Она только включает факел. Для выполнения поиска необходимо перед командой **[[(% style="color:#8d69b2" %)**М3**>>doc:Руководство пользователя.Описание M-кодов.Стандартные M-коды модуля плазменной резки.WebHome]](%%)** поместить команду **[[(% style="color:#8d69b2" %)**М100**>>doc:Руководство пользователя.Описание M-кодов.Стандартные M-коды модуля плазменной резки.WebHome]](%%)**, которая выполняет только поиск материала без фактического поджига дуги.